I used the wrong diagnosis code in a dental claim to Medicare. The medicare rep told me that I have to correct it when the claim is processed. Are there any circumstances? What will happen now? Thank you.

Depending on the diagnosis code you used their may be repercussions to the patient (i.e. if you placed a diagnosis of malignancy and it was benign) Once the claim is processed you will need to immediately put in for a claim correction with Medicare, they will usually ask you to use one of the forms on their website for this type of correction.
